The Most Common Car Noises (And What They Could Mean)
Most vehicle problems don't happen overnight. Instead, they usually begin with subtle warning signs like the following:
Squealing When You Brake
A high-pitched squeal while braking often indicates worn brake pads that are ready for replacement. It may also point to worn or damaged brake rotors.
Clicking While Turning
A clicking noise while turning may be a sign of worn CV joints or axle components. These parts transfer power from the transmission to the wheels, and worn or damaged components can eventually affect your vehicle's performance.
Grinding Sounds
Grinding noises should never be ignored. They can indicate severely worn brake components, failing wheel bearings, or transmission issues.
Knocking Under the Hood
Engine knocking can be caused by low oil levels, ignition issues, or other engine-related problems. Ignoring the noise may lead to increased engine wear over time.
Humming or Roaring While Driving
A humming or roaring sound that increases with speed may be caused by uneven tire wear, worn wheel bearings, or differential issues. These problems can also affect your vehicle's handling if left unaddressed.

Here are a few maintenance practices that can help prevent common vehicle noises:
Change your engine oil regularly to keep moving parts properly lubricated and reduce unnecessary wear. Learn how often you should change your oil.
Have your brakes inspected to monitor the condition of brake pads, rotors, and other braking components before excessive wear develops. Here are some signs that your car needs a brake inspection.
Rotate your tires according to your vehicle's maintenance schedule to encourage even tread wear and reduce road noise.
Inspect your suspension and steering system to catch worn shocks, struts, and other components that can affect ride quality.
Check essential fluid levels to help important vehicle systems operate efficiently.
Inspect belts and hoses for signs of cracking, fraying, or wear before they lead to unwanted noises or breakdowns.
Test your battery and charging system to help ensure reliable starting and proper electrical performance.

Why is my car making a squeaking noise?
A squeaking noise can be caused by worn brake pads, loose belts, suspension components, or even tire-related issues. The exact cause depends on when the noise occurs, so it's best to have it professionally inspected.
Can regular maintenance prevent car noises?
Routine maintenance helps reduce normal wear and allows technicians to identify developing issues. Whether you drive a sedan, SUV, or truck, staying on top of maintenance can help keep your vehicle running quietly and reliably.
What car noises are most serious?
Grinding, knocking, and loud metal-on-metal noises should never be ignored because they can indicate problems with critical vehicle systems. If you hear any of these sounds, schedule an inspection as soon as possible.
Should I drive if my car is making a grinding noise?
It's generally not recommended. A grinding noise may indicate a problem with your brakes, wheel bearings, or transmission, and continuing to drive could lead to additional damage or affect your safety.
